In order to address this space limitation, only windows.iso, linux.iso and winPreVista.iso are bundled with ESXi.
Application, Version, General Availability, End of Standard Lifecycle. However, this approach poses a challenge due to limited space in ProductLocker. End-of-life notices for FlexNet Publisher. These ISO images are deployed on ProductLocker partition of the ESXi.
In earlier versions, VMware Tools ISO images were shipped with the ESXi image. While preparing the system for VMware Tools 10.3.0 installation, Microsoft Visual C++ 2017 Redistributable is installed on the system as a prerequisite. VMware Tools 10.3.0 depends on and ships Microsoft Visual C++ 2017 Redistributable version 14.x.

Microsoft System Center Configuration Manager (SCCM) is used to manage the deployment of Windows applications across an enterprise and can be used to deploy VMware Tools.
Offline bundles with VMware Tools VIB that can be installed on vSphere 5.5.x, 6.0.x and 6.5.x releases using vSphere Update Manager.
With offline bundles and the integration with SCCM to distribute and upgrade VMware Tools, VMware Tools 10.2.0 brings in several improvements to lifecycle management.
